Asia-Bound Tanker Exits Red Sea Via Suez as Others Risk Strait

An Asia-bound supertanker carrying Saudi oil has taken the longer Suez Canal route instead of the Bab el-Mandeb Strait due to Houthi threats. Other vessels continue to navigate the riskier Bab el-Mandeb Strait despite heightened uncertainty in the region.
